CONTRACT SPECIALIST for Olympic Area Agency on Aging (O3A) based in Aberdeen, WA or Sequim, WA.
Bachelor's Degree in liberal arts or social /health sciences and minimum of three years’ experience in an administrative planning position, preferably in the human service field, focused on services in a community setting. Experience working in the field of community-based long-term care, social services planning and management, aging and/or disability services, and/or human services. Experience managing government and private contracts. Experience conducting competitive bidding processes. Experience in assessing compliance. Experience in provision of technical support to contractors.
Requires current WDL & insured vehicle.
$67,098 to $88,039 annually.
40 hrs./wk. Non-Exempt.
Benefits include: 12 paid holidays per year, paid annual and sick leave accrual, WA PERS pension plan, medical plan including vision, dental plan, EAP counseling, life and AD&D insurance.
